Torna indietro
Image of Tricentis Tosca – La Suite di Automazione dei Test Basata su Modelli di Primo Livello

Tricentis Tosca – La Suite di Automazione dei Test Basata su Modelli di Primo Livello

Tricentis Tosca è una suite di automazione dei test aziendale di primo livello, basata su modelli, progettata per tester QA e team DevOps. Abilita il testing continuo di applicazioni aziendali complesse attraverso un approccio senza codice e potenziato dall'AI. Astraendo le complessità tecniche, Tosca consente ai team di ottenere una maggiore copertura dei test, accelerare i cicli di rilascio e garantire la resilienza delle applicazioni, rendendolo uno strumento fondamentale per l'assicurazione della qualità software moderna.

Cos'è Tricentis Tosca?

Tricentis Tosca è una piattaforma completa di automazione dei test costruita su una metodologia basata su modelli. Invece di scrivere script test riga per riga, gli utenti creano modelli dinamici della struttura dell'applicazione e della sua logica di business. Questo modello funge da unica fonte di verità per i casi di test, che Tosca genera ed esegue automaticamente. Si specializza nel testing end-to-end attraverso una vasta gamma di tecnologie, tra cui web, mobile, API, mainframe e applicazioni pre-confezionate come SAP e Salesforce, rendendolo ideale per ambienti aziendali su larga scala e integrati, dove gli strumenti di automazione tradizionali faticano.

Caratteristiche Principali di Tricentis Tosca

Automazione dei Test Basata su Modelli

Il nucleo della potenza di Tosca risiede nel suo approccio basato su modelli. Si modellano visivamente schermate, elementi e dati dell'applicazione. Il motore AI di Tosca (Tosca Commander) utilizza quindi questo modello per generare e mantenere automaticamente i casi di test. Questo riduce drasticamente i tempi di creazione e manutenzione degli script, aumenta la riusabilità e rende l'automazione dei test accessibile a membri del team non tecnici.

Testing Continuo End-to-End

Tosca fornisce una piattaforma unificata per testare l'intero panorama applicativo. Si integra perfettamente nelle pipeline CI/CD (come Jenkins, Azure DevOps) per abilitare il testing shift-left. Le sue capacità di esecuzione distribuita consentono esecuzioni parallele di test su migliaia di scenari, fornendo un feedback rapido sullo stato di salute dell'applicazione ad ogni build.

Testing Basato sul Rischio e Analisi

Tosca va oltre l'esecuzione con un testing basato sul rischio integrato. Aiuta a dare priorità ai casi di test in base al rischio aziendale e alle modifiche al codice. Accoppiato con dashboard analitiche dettagliate, i team ottengono insight azionabili sulla copertura dei test, le tendenze dei difetti e la prontezza al rilascio, consentendo decisioni basate sui dati riguardanti la qualità del software.

Interfaccia Senza Codice e Specializzazione SAP/Salesforce

Con la sua interfaccia drag-and-drop e senza codice, Tosca abbassa la barriera per l'automazione avanzata dei test. Offre integrazioni predefinite e ottimizzazioni approfondite per piattaforme ERP e CRM come SAP e Salesforce, permettendo un testing robusto di flussi di lavoro aziendali complessi senza codifica personalizzata.

A Chi è Rivolto Tricentis Tosca?

Tricentis Tosca è progettato per aziende di medie e grandi dimensioni con stack applicativi complessi e multi-tecnologia. È lo strumento preferito per: team QA aziendali che gestiscono il testing per implementazioni su larga scala di SAP, Oracle o Salesforce; team DevOps e CI/CD che necessitano di automazione robusta e integrata nelle pipeline per la consegna continua; organizzazioni che affrontano sfide con la manutenzione dei test, cercando di passare da un'automazione fragile basata su script a un testing resiliente basato su modelli; e analisti aziendali o esperti di dominio che devono contribuire alla creazione di test senza imparare linguaggi di programmazione.

Prezzi e Piano Gratuito di Tricentis Tosca

Tricentis Tosca è una soluzione software aziendale premium e non offre un piano gratuito tradizionale o una versione open-source. I prezzi sono personalizzati in base ai moduli specifici richiesti (ad es., Tosca Commander, Esecuzione Distribuita, Testing API), alla scala di distribuzione e al numero di utenti. I potenziali clienti devono contattare direttamente le vendite di Tricentis per un preventivo. Solitamente offrono impegni di proof-of-concept e dimostrazioni dettagliate per illustrare il valore della piattaforma e il ROI per il proprio ambiente di testing specifico.

Casi d'uso comuni

Vantaggi principali

Pro e contro

Pro

  • La potente automazione basata su modelli riduce drasticamente lo sforzo di creazione e manutenzione degli script
  • Supporto eccezionale per ambienti aziendali complessi, in particolare SAP e Salesforce
  • Capacità di testing end-to-end complete su UI, API e sistemi backend
  • Forte integrazione con gli strumenti CI/CD per un'adozione DevOps senza intoppi

Contro

  • Il costo elevato e il modello di prezzi orientato alle aziende possono essere proibitivi per piccoli team o startup
  • Curva di apprendimento iniziale ripida associata alla padronanza del paradigma basato su modelli e della piattaforma
  • Principalmente un'applicazione desktop basata su Windows, con supporto meno nativo per gli ecosistemi macOS o Linux

Domande frequenti

Tricentis Tosca è gratuito?

No, Tricentis Tosca non è gratuito. È una suite di automazione dei test aziendale commerciale con prezzi personalizzati. Non esiste un piano gratuito pubblico o un'edizione community. Le organizzazioni interessate devono contattare le vendite di Tricentis per una dimostrazione e un preventivo basato sulle loro esigenze specifiche.

Tricentis Tosca è adatto per team Agile e DevOps?

Sì, Tricentis Tosca è molto apprezzato per ambienti Agile e DevOps. Il suo approccio basato su modelli promuove la riusabilità e una creazione più rapida dei casi di test, mentre le sue robuste integrazioni con strumenti CI/CD (come Jenkins, Azure DevOps, GitLab) abilitano un vero testing continuo. Funzionalità come l'esecuzione distribuita e l'analisi basata sul rischio aiutano i team Agile a ottenere feedback rapidi e azionabili su ogni build.

In cosa differisce il testing basato su modelli in Tosca da Selenium?

Mentre Selenium è una libreria per l'automazione del browser che richiede la scrittura manuale di script in linguaggi come Java o Python, Tosca utilizza un approccio visivo basato su modelli. In Tosca, si modella la struttura dell'applicazione e lo strumento genera automaticamente gli script di test. Questo rende i test di Tosca generalmente più resilienti ai cambiamenti dell'interfaccia utente e accessibili a chi non programma, mentre Selenium offre un controllo più di basso livello ma richiede maggiori competenze tecniche e sforzi di manutenzione.

Tricentis Tosca può testare applicazioni mobili?

Sì, Tricentis Tosca include funzionalità per il testing di applicazioni mobili. Supporta il testing di applicazioni native, ibride e web mobili su piattaforme Android e iOS. Il testing può essere eseguito su simulatori, emulatori e dispositivi fisici reali, integrando i test mobili negli stessi flussi di lavoro dei processi aziendali end-to-end testati su applicazioni web e desktop.

Conclusione

Per i tester QA e i team aziendali che affrontano la complessità del testing di applicazioni integrate e su larga scala, Tricentis Tosca si erge come una soluzione potente e strategica. Il suo paradigma di automazione basato su modelli affronta i punti critici di manutenzione e scalabilità che affliggono gli strumenti di scripting tradizionali. Sebbene l'investimento e la curva di apprendimento siano significativi, il ritorno in termini di velocità di rilascio accelerata, copertura dei test completa e costi a lungo termine ridotti rende Tosca una scelta di primo livello per le organizzazioni impegnate in una seria assicurazione della qualità continua. È particolarmente adatto alle aziende in cui la qualità del software è direttamente legata al rischio aziendale e alla continuità operativa.